An opportunity is available for a Speech-Language Pathology Assistant (SLPA) to support K-12 students in a school setting based in Butte, MT. This contract position involves assisting licensed speech-language pathologists in delivering therapy services to students, helping improve their communication skills and contributing to their overall educational development.
Key Responsibilities:
- Assist speech-language pathologists in implementing individualized treatment plans for students
- Support screening, assessment, and therapy sessions under supervision
- Document progress and maintain accurate records
- Collaborate effectively with educators, therapists, and parents
- Help prepare materials and manage therapy schedules
Qualifications and Desired Experience:
- Certification or license as a Speech-Language Pathology Assistant (SLPA)
- Experience working with K-12 students in educational environments preferred
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ills
- Ability to follow treatment plans and document student progress accurately
- Commitment to supporting students speech and language development
